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Liverpool to Dungarvan is to bus and fly which costs €50 - €170 and takes 8h 37m.
The fastest way to get from Liverpool to Dungarvan is to fly and bus which takes 6h 17m and costs €85 - €250.
The distance between Liverpool and Dungarvan is 472 km.
The best way to get from Liverpool to Dungarvan without a car is to train and ferry and bus which takes 12h 8m and costs €120 - €200.
It takes approximately 6h 47m to get from Liverpool to Dungarvan, including transfers.
There are 128+ hotels available in Dungarvan.
What companies run services between Liverpool, England and Dungarvan, IE-WD, Ireland?
There is no direct connection from Liverpool to Dungarvan. However, you can take the train to Liverpool South Parkway, walk to Liverpool South Parkway, take the bus to Liverpool John Lennon Airport, walk to Liverpool (LPL) airport, fly to Dublin Airport (DUB), walk to Dublin Airport Zone 16, take the line 726 bus to Red Cow Luas, then take the bus to Dungarvan. Alternatively, you can take a train from Liverpool Lime Street to Dungarvan via Rhyl, Holyhead, Holyhead Ferry, Dublin Ferryport B+I, The Point, Red Cow, and Red Cow Luas in around 12h 8m.
